🍂 Autumn Bliss: Golden Moments Await
If there’s one season locals rave about, it’s autumn (September-November). Think golden leaves, clear blue skies, and temps hovering around 18°C—basically perfection. This is when Qingdao truly shines as a traveler’s paradise. Stroll through historic German architecture or hike Laoshan Mountain without breaking a sweat. Plus, foodies rejoice because this time of year brings fresh seafood galore! Lobster anyone? 🦞✨

❄️ Winter Chill: A Cozy Getaway?
Winter (December-February) might not be everyone’s cup of tea ☕, but hear me out. Sure, temperatures dip down to 0°C, and frosty mornings aren’t uncommon, but Qingdao has its own kind of charm during this quiet season. Imagine cozying up in a local café sipping hot chocolate or exploring quieter streets where history whispers louder than crowds. Bonus points for witnessing snowfall on the old buildings—it’s like stepping into a postcard! ❄️
And let’s not forget, winter means cheaper flights and accommodations. Budget travelers, take note! 💸
🌸 Spring Awakening: Fresh Air & Blossoms
Springtime (March-May) in Qingdao is all about renewal. Flowers bloom, cherry blossoms dance in the wind 🌸, and life returns to the beaches and parks. Temperatures rise gently, making outdoor adventures irresistible. Whether you’re biking along scenic routes or joining locals celebrating festivals, spring invites you to reconnect with nature. Just be prepared for occasional rain showers—it’s Mother Nature’s way of keeping things interesting! ☔
